A drowning person doesn’t politely ask for help—he cries out with everything in him. That is the kind of seeking God responds to. God does not ignore sin. He allows people to feel the weight of their wrong choices. Sometimes misery becomes the doorway to salvation.
Text: Hosea 5:15
“Then I will return to my lair until they have borne their guilt and seek my face—in their misery they will earnestly seek me.”
